This print from Granger Art on Demand showcases a historical artifact that holds great significance in American history - the "STAMP ACT, 1765-66" handbill. This powerful image takes us back to a pivotal moment during the colonial era when tensions between Britain and America were escalating. The photograph captures the essence of rebellion as it displays an intricately handwritten warning against the use of stamps, symbolizing protest against the Stamp Act imposed by British authorities. The carefully crafted words on this mid-18th century handbill serve as a reminder of how ordinary citizens united to resist oppressive taxation policies.
